Central Madera, Interchange ramps to be shut
Highway exits and on-ramps in the center of Madera and at the State Route 145 Interchange could be closed for quite a while as the state completes its work widening SR 99.
To allow businesses and residents a chance to learn about detour plans and ask questions, the California Department of Transportation (Caltrans) and Granite Construction will hold an informal Public Outreach Meeting at 3 p.m. today in Madera City Hall Chambers, 205 West 4th Street.
The meeting will cover the final stage (Phase 4) of construction along State Route 99, which includes the completion of the # 2 lanes closest to the shoulders and shoulder reconstruction along both the northbound and southbound lanes of SR 99 from just south of the Gateway Drive Exit to just north of the Avenue 16 Exit within the city limits of Madera.
For this phase, the north and southbound ramps at 4th Street in Central Madera and at the SR 145 Interchange would be closed for the long term, according to Gloria Rodriguez of the state’s Department of Transportation...
